"Arsenal De Belles Melodies" (French for "arsenal of beautiful melodies") is the second studio album by Congolese singer Fally Ipupa. It was released on June 22, 2009 and contains 16 tracks. It is the second album by Fally Ipupa to be produced by David Monsoh. On the album, Ipupa collaborated with Olivia Longott, a former member of 50 Cent's G-Unit musical group, on the song Chaise Électrique and with Krys on the song Sexy Dance.

The album is the second album by Ipupa to go gold for selling over 100,000 copies in less than a month, including 40,000 sales in a week. This was a record for a Congolese artist.
